| Features | APF | RERA |
|---|---|---|
| Full Form | Approved Finance Number | Real Estate (Regulation and Development) Act |
| Issued by | Banks or Housing Finance Companies | State RERA Authorities under the Central Act |
| Purpose | Certified that a project is loan-eligible and has passed bank-level scrutiny | Ensures legal registration and transparency as well as buyer protection. |
| Scope of Scrutiny | Legal title, land approvals, layout plans, and developer reputation | Land title, approvals, project delivery timelines, agent/developer conduct. |
| Buyer Benefit | Easier home loan sanctions and project reliability. | Legal remedy, transparency, compensation for delays and violations |
| Applicability | Project wise; each lender conducting APF checks may assign its own number. | Mandatory for all projects. |
| Transparency Level | Moderate; mostly internal to banks | High; all project details are publicly available on RERA’s website. |
| Helps with loan sanctions | Yes | No |
| Mandatory | Optional but highly recommended | Yes; compulsory by law. |
